Output 50be15e8d922ae7a039b4303d785af635890a79880137c1744da0f60a18f7885: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a23dacc1e7dff1322444c2faf3904f90c661a46 OP_EQUAL
address
36zS4txGsCDRwx7E9dTvjVcmmJwmD2oN1e
transaction
50be15e8d922ae7a039b4303d785af635890a79880137c1744da0f60a18f7885
spent
true